Bind Error 125 Address Already In Use
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n bind address already in use linux more about Stack Overflow the company Business Learn more about hiring developers or address already in use ubuntu pos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community bind failed address already in use iperf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up bind failed. Error: Address already in use [closed] up vote how to use so_reuseaddr 13 down vote favorite 8 I am new in Socket programming,Linux ,C.. This is my Bind part of the Socket program //Bind if( bind(socket_desc,(struct sockaddr *)&server , sizeof(server)) < 0) { //print the error message perror("bind failed. Error"); return 1; } puts("bind done"); But it gives user-desktop:~/socket_programming$ ./server Socket created bind failed. Error: Address already in use I don't know how to fix this problem.. Please give me
Address Already In Use Socket
a solution.. c linux sockets share|improve this question edited Jun 17 at 8:30 Chaitanya Bapat 11815 asked Mar 4 '13 at 9:59 TamiL 1,09431230 closed as too localized by Nick, dandan78, BЈовић, EJP, Öö Tiib Mar 4 '13 at 12:08 This question is unlikely to help any future visitors; it is only relevant to a small geographic area, a specific moment in time, or an extraordinarily narrow situation that is not generally applicable to the worldwide audience of the internet. For help making this question more broadly applicable, visit the help center.If this question can be reworded to fit the rules in the help center, please edit the question. 1 Use a different port number? –Nick Mar 4 '13 at 10:01 2 Use an address that isn't already in use. –David Schwartz Mar 4 '13 at 10:02 I got it.. I choose different ports... Thanks for the help .. Thanks all. –TamiL Mar 4 '13 at 10:18 1 I faced the same issue when I closed the server program with client program still running. This put the socket into TIME_WAIT state. Here's an elaborate discussion of the problem: How to forcibly close a socket in TIME_WAIT? –Nare
Java, SQL, and other programming languages here. Search Forums Show Threads Show Posts Tag Search Advanced Search Unanswered Threads Find All Thanked Posts Go to Page... unix and linux operating commands how to solve error
Bind Address Already In Use Ssh
: Bind: Address Already in Use Programming Thread Tools address already in use python Search this Thread Display Modes #1 07-24-2006 bhakti Registered User Join Date: Sep 2005 Last Activity: 19 September bind: address already in use mac 2007, 6:48 AM EDT Posts: 13 Thanks: 0 Thanked 0 Times in 0 Posts how to solve error : Bind: Address Already in Use hi i have created socket program with proper IP address and port no http://stackoverflow.com/questions/15198834/bind-failed-error-address-already-in-use client side port no 1085[listen] and 1086[send] gateway side port no 1086[listen_to_client] and 1085[send_to_client] and port no 1087[listen_to_receiver] and 1088[send_to_receiver] receiver side port no 1088[listen_to_client] and 1087[send_to_client] well it works fine on client and gateway side not on receiver and gateway side it gives error on address binding. can any one suggest why this happing so when this bind error comes thankx Last edited by bhakti; 07-24-2006 at 05:43 AM.. Remove advertisements Sponsored Links http://www.unix.com/programming/29475-how-solve-error-bind-address-already-use.html bhakti View Public Profile Find all posts by bhakti #2 07-24-2006 grial El UNIX es como un toro Join Date: Jun 2006 Last Activity: 1 December 2008, 8:39 AM EST Location: Madrid (Spain) Posts: 531 Thanks: 0 Thanked 1 Time in 1 Post The error is clear: The IP/port are in use. Try to gess what, among all the ports your app uses, is the one in use. To do so, use lsof if it's available on your system or netstat if it's not. Regards. Remove advertisements Sponsored Links grial View Public Profile Find all posts by grial #3 07-27-2006 Hitori kharkovpromenade.com.ua Join Date: Jun 2006 Last Activity: 10 December 2011, 9:33 AM EST Posts: 360 Thanks: 0 Thanked 9 Times in 8 Posts Sometimes you try to bind() and have an error "Address already in use". Someone is still handling the port. You can either wait for it to clear (a minute or so), or add code to your program allowing it to reuse the port: Code: int tr=1; // kill "Address already in use" error message if (setsockopt(listener,SOL_SOCKET,SO_REUSEADDR,&tr,sizeof(int)) == -1) { perror("setsockopt"); exit(1); } Remove advertisements Sponsored Links Hitori View Public Profile Visit Hitori's homepage! Find all posts by Hitori « Previous Thread | Next Thread »
commun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n http://askubuntu.com/questions/277162/apache-fails-to-start-address-already-in-use-but-not-really more about hiring developers or posting ads with us Ask Ubuntu Questions Tags Users Badges Unanswered Ask Question _ Ask Ubuntu is a question and answer site for Ubuntu users and developers. Join them; it only takes a minute: https://www.ibm.com/support/knowledgecenter/SSSHRK_3.9.0/com.ibm.netcool_OMNIbus.doc_7.3.1/omnibus/wip/common/reference/omn_trb_listenererror.html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top Apache fails to start, Address already in use (but not really) up vote 23 address already down vote favorite 7 I'm trying to set up a VM running Ubuntu 12.04. I have two virtual hosts configured using port 80, but Apache will not start. I get this error: (98) Address already in use: make_sock: could not bind to address 0.0.0.0:80 The output of netstat -tulpn shows that nothing is using port 80. What could possibly be causing this? 12.04 apache2 vm share|improve this question asked Apr 2 '13 at 14:59 Gunner Barnes 124117 address already in are you starting it as root? By default only root can open ports below 1024. –onse Apr 2 '13 at 15:02 Yes, I am. It was running at one point when I had just one virtual host configured, so I've since removed the other virtual host to try to remedy the issue, but no luck with that either. –Gunner Barnes Apr 2 '13 at 15:15 Does you host have something running on port 80 and you're in bridged mode for the guest? I don't know that it would do that, but it seems probable –RobotHumans Apr 2 '13 at 15:41 Have you tried the suggestions from Starting apache fails (could not bind to address 0.0.0.0:80)? And please also include the output of grep -ri listen /etc/apache and sudo netstat -ntlp | grep 80. –gertvdijk Apr 2 '13 at 19:57 1 grep -ri listen /etc/apache2 outputs: etc/apache2/httpd.conf: Listen 80 /etc/apache2/httpd.conf: Listen 443 /etc/apache2/ports.conf: Listen 80 /etc/apache2/httpd.conf: Listen 443 /etc/apache2/httpd.conf: Listen 443 sudo netstat -ntlp | grep 80 outputs nothing at all. –Gunner Barnes Apr 3 '13 at 14:28 | show 1 more comment 9 Answers 9 active oldest votes up vote 9 down vote When I had this problem, it turned out to be because my Apache couldn't start on boot because I had an SSL site that required a password to be entered for the